Research and Archivist Librarian (Gde 2) - Macarthur & Bowral -Temp FT South Western Sydney Local Health DistrictREQUIRED REQUISITION: 610195Employment Type: Temporary Full Time, 38 hours per week until June 2026Location: Campbelltown HospitalPosition Classification: Librarian Grade 2Remuneration: $1,899.70 - $2,146.09 per weekAbout the OpportunityThe Macarthur & Bowral Library Service is recruiting for a Research and Archivist Librarian (Grade 2) to join our dynamic Library team. This position is based at Campbelltown Hospital in the Macarthur Clinical Library and will also be supporting staff at Camden and Bowral & District Hospitals.This is an exciting and rewarding opportunity to develop your career as a health librarian and join a small, friendly and dedicated team. This essential role assists in the delivery of safe and high-quality health services through support for research, staff development and evidence-based practice. Archives experience is desirable but not essential. If you are interested, or would like more information, please contact Judy Reading on (02) 4634 9341 for a confidential discussion.What you will be doing and where you will be working are described below.What You''ll be DoingThe Research and Archivist Librarian is responsible for coordinating Library research support programs including a literature search service and research skills training and providing a range of high-quality, client-focused information services in support of evidence-based patient care, professional development, and research, under the leadership of the Library Manager. The role is also required to identify, catalogue and promote an archival collection to preserve the history of the Hospitals and is responsible for the management of the Library in the absence of the Library Manager. The position is full-time and fixed term until 30 June 2026.Where You''ll Be WorkingCampbelltown Hospital, located in the heart of the Macarthur region, is a leading tertiary hospital within the South Western Sydney Local Health District.
